The BSA Analyst plays a critical role in ensuring the bank's compliance with the Bank Secrecy Act (BSA),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ations, and related laws. This position is responsible for conducting Enhanced Due Diligence (EDD) reviews of high-risk customers, investigating and analyzing complex financial activity, and making informed decisions on BSA-related alerts and cases. Key responsibilities include completing Suspicious Activity Reports (SARs), supporting the Customer Identification Program (CIP), monitoring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C) compliance, and fulfilling Currency Transaction Reporting (CTR) and USA PATRIOT Act requirements. The analyst serves as a subject matter expert and contributes to the integrity of the bank's compliance program through thorough investigations, clear documentation, and effective collaboration across business units.
